' i 7...APIA‘ii, 17-7' 4 St.,.-`\,"1'7'..,)rci- 4.. -1.----"Al .0,7—.. 47.11116-;;;k:>-:1741":".it 40.9 <br /> N. <br /> A safe educational walking path from HOlualoa School to The Kona Imin Center would <br /> provide access and benefit families, residents and visitors alike. There are no alternative <br /> walking paths or roads through Holualoa village which have become overcrowded and <br /> dangerous for walking. <br /> Anticipated Use <br /> • Public access through a walking connector path from the HOlualoa School to The <br /> Imin Center. The applicant would also like to see this property used as an outdoor <br /> classroom and reforestation reparian site. <br /> • Property is located in the center of the traditional Kuahewa Filed System famous <br /> for the agriculture systems of traditional Hawaii. Stone features and small walls <br /> exist on property that were once used in partner with agriculture systems to slow <br /> and channel water. This parcel was once part of the parcel makai (westward) <br /> which is still the home of the Kona Koyasan Daishiji Mission established in 1925. <br /> • Preservation of this parcel to protect the riparian and watershed area which <br /> contributes to protection of the aquifer recharge and coastal environment <br /> • Property is a prime location for appropriate biocultural agricultural or forest <br /> restoration that preserves and enhances the riparian functions.. Property also <br /> serves as a buffer from the busy Mamalahoa Highway traffic. <br /> 1.25 <br />
